Contextual Overview

2 And he said, The Lord is my Rock, my walled town, and my saviour, even mine; 3 My God, my Rock, in him will I put my faith; my breastplate, and the horn of my salvation, my high tower, and my safe place; my saviour, who keeps me safe from the violent man. 4 I will send up my cry to the Lord, who is to be praised; so will I be made safe from those who are against me. 5 For the waves of death came round me, and the seas of evil put me in fear; 6 The cords of hell were round me: the nets of death came on me. 7 In my trouble my voice went up to the Lord, and my cry to my God: my voice came to his hearing in his holy Temple, and my prayer came to his ears. 8 Then the earth was moved with a violent shock; the bases of heaven were moved and shaking, because he was angry. 9 There went up a smoke from his nose, and a fire of destruction from his mouth: coals were lighted by it. 10 The heavens were bent, so that he might come down; and it was dark under his feet. 11 And he went through the air, seated on a storm-cloud: going quickly on the wings of the wind.
